RE: AIX + Oracle = Memory + Swap

Главная Форумы POWER Systems AIX/Hardware AIX + Oracle = Memory + Swap RE: AIX + Oracle = Memory + Swap

#2431
uxTuaHgp
Участник

Кривой клиент абсолютно ни при чем.
PGA_AGGREGATE_TARGET – это не ограничение как SGA_TARGET, это значение, к которому оракл будет стремиться, но это значение может быть легко превышено, и бороться с этим практически невозможно.
Расчет памяти вы привели не совсем верный. Именно из пальца 😉
SGA_TARGET уйдет подо всякие кэши и буфера, PGA_AGGREGATE_TARGET – область сортировок и всяческих связываний и преобразований.
А где же селиться пользовательским процессам оракла, которых по умолчанию столько же, сколько и сессий пользователей + еще системные процессы оракла (для ОС я допускаю, что хватит и 256М)?
Я прикидываю примерно мегабайт по 6-8 на каждый процесс, хотя это надо анализировать, может выйти и больше.
Если сессий на сервере порядка 600, то только под процессы пользовательские нужно отвести 4ГБ, а не 20-30% оперативной памяти сервера.
Если настроить MTS, то расклад будет конечно другой.

Что касается тюнинга памяти, то я у себя сделал так:
vmo -p -o minperm%=5
vmo -p -o maxclient%=10
vmo -p -o maxperm%=20

Этим и ограничился.
Про RMAN я недопонял. RMAN дажебэкапит с томов с CIO медленно?